我已经同时使用cscope和ctags来帮助浏览C代码。
现在使用C ++代码,我正在尝试使用它们来帮助代码浏览。这就是cscope和ctags DB的构建方式:
$ find . -name '*.cc' -o -name '*.h' > cscope.files
$ cscope -b
$ ctags -L cscope.files
调用cscope:
$ cscope -d
一旦我搜索符号并从cscope中打开相关文件,我就无法找到其他符号的定义。错误是:
E433: No tags file
E426: tag not found: Parser
Press ENTER or type command to continue
对于什么是错的任何想法?
谢谢!
答案 0 :(得分:0)
通过.vimrc文件,我找到了一个指向无效位置的标签条目。删除该条目解决了这个问题。
谢谢!